How To Write a Popular Google Knol Article
1. Content: the quality of content goes a long way towards determining how successful your Knol will be. Essentially, you want to write about a topic that intrigues people (see an example here). You also want to avoid the “quick hit” syndrome. In other words, you don’t want to write a Knol that is only 100 words long and doesn’t truly provide any valuable information to readers. You don’t necessarily have to write an extremely long Knol to be successful. But you want to convey information that is verifiable and leave the door open for your readers to explore your topic more after they are done reading your Knol.
2. Research: the best way to burn a Knol down to the ground is by skipping the research process. If you want to be successful in the Knol community, you need to research your topics rigorously. You don’t have to be an absolute expert in the topic of your choosing. But it is important to be right. Don’t make statements that you are not absolutely sure about or you’ll lose your credibility.
3. Start: your introduction piece is extremely important to your Knol’s success. With your introduction piece, you get the chance to write an elevator speech to help potential readers decide if the would want to invest time reading your Knol.
4. Engage: engage your readers and you are half-way through making your Knol successful. Knol is not a blog post, so I am not suggesting that you should specifically ask your readers for comments, but you can engage them and make them want to comment by setting the right tone for your Knol. If the topic that you choose is controversial or leaves the door open for argument, then you can expect your readers to comment on your work. Engaging your users and getting their feedback not only will help to get votes, it will help you to improve your work in the future.
5. Presentation: everyone likes an article that is brilliantly presented. So don’t forget to cite your work, and add graphics and visual aids to your work to give your audience the chance to better understand and appreciate your work. Tip: use bullet points to drive your point(s) home.
6. Finish: your Knol’s finish is almost as important as your start. Your finale should not only summarize what you have talked about in your Knol but also leave the door open for argument. I am not suggesting that you should have a cliffhanger, but don’t cover your topic from A to Z. Leave some space for your readers to participate and contribute with their comments.
7. Reputation: once you start writing Knols, you are going to get rated by the community. The better your Knols are, the better reputation you will have in the community. If you are a marketer and you have spammed Digg or other sites to push your message, keep in mind that the strategy won’t work on Knol. You will need to provide value to your readers, and if you don’t, your reputation takes a hit. If you drop the ball enough times, your articles may get ignored or even voted down by the community so make sure you behave properly.
